To fully appreciate the collection, it helps to understand the chronological order of Tintin's adventures. The series evolved dramatically from early political propaganda into highly researched, sophisticated geopolitical thrillers. The Formative Years (1929–1934)
The black-and-white debut features crude drawings and heavy political propaganda.
